Illia Polosukhin is considered as one of the founding fathers of modern AI. He is best known as the Co-Founder and Chief Technology Officer of NEAR Protocol, a fully-sharded, proof-of-stake blockchain built for mainstream adoption. Together with his co-founder Alex Skidanov, he is leading a change within the applications of AI by challenging the established role of developers and creating value for the end consumer. Illia is a visionary entrepreneur and technology pioneer at the forefront of the blockchain and artificial intelligence revolution. He has more than 10 years of industry experience, including 3 years at Google where he was a major TensorFlow contributor and managed the team building question-answering capabilities for the core Google search, as well as an author of several notable research papers.

GOOGLE

  • Illia was Engineering Manager and Researcher at Google, where he led a Deep Learning team working on Natural Language Understanding and TensorFlow.

  • He co-wrote the now famous 2017 paper, “Attention Is All You Need” along with seven Google colleagues, who have collectively become known as the “Transformer 8.”

  • He is one of the co-creators of the transformer model — the type of AI architecture that powers generative AI systems like ChatGPT (the “T” stands for transformer).

  • His research was instrumental in laying the groundwork for the major LLMs of today, such as ChatGPT and Bard. 

  • He started his career as a Software Engineer at Salford Systems, where he was in charge of the development of new tools for big data predictive analytics, text mining, geo mining, and the refinement of the existing Salford Predictive Miner toolkit.
